Understanding U2I Foundation

What is U2I Foundation?

U2I Foundation, also known as Unite to Impact Foundation, is a nonprofit mission ecosystem focused on NGO institutional strengthening, nonprofit transformation, guided impact execution, CSR partnership readiness, and structured community impact systems in India.

What is U2I Foundation really building?

U2I Foundation is building an institutional strengthening ecosystem for NGOs. It is designed to help mission-driven organizations become structured, documented, governance-ready, implementation-capable, and partnership-ready institutions.

Is U2I Foundation only a donation-based charity?

No. U2I Foundation is not only a donation-based charity. It is a structured nonprofit institutional strengthening ecosystem focused on NGO transformation, guided execution, institutional readiness, and impact ecosystem building.

How is U2I different from a conventional NGO?

A conventional NGO usually implements its own charitable activities. U2I Foundation focuses on strengthening NGOs and building structured nonprofit ecosystems so grassroots organizations can become stronger institutions capable of credible implementation.

From NGO to Institution

Why was U2I Foundation created?

U2I Foundation was created to address a systemic gap in the social sector: many NGOs have good intentions and field commitment but lack structure, documentation, governance discipline, evidence systems, and partnership readiness.

What problem does U2I solve for NGOs?

U2I helps NGOs solve problems related to weak governance, incomplete documentation, poor reporting discipline, limited impact evidence, low CSR readiness, informal execution, and lack of institutional confidence.

What does NGO institutional strengthening mean?

NGO institutional strengthening means improving internal systems, governance, documentation, compliance readiness, operating discipline, reporting quality, evidence creation, and partnership confidence.

What is nonprofit transformation?

Nonprofit transformation is the process of moving an organization from informal activity and reactive compliance toward structured governance, measurable execution, documented systems, stakeholder trust, and long-term institutional maturity.

Structured Growth Through Action

What is the NGO Strengthening Accelerator?

The U2I NGO Strengthening Accelerator is a structured transformation journey for NGOs focused on governance, documentation, compliance readiness, guided pilot execution, impact evidence, reporting discipline, and partnership readiness.

Is the accelerator only training?

No. The accelerator is not intended to be only classroom training. It is designed as a structured strengthening journey that combines learning, systems thinking, documentation, implementation orientation, and guided pilot readiness.

What are guided impact pilots?

Guided impact pilots are structured field initiatives that help NGOs move from intent to disciplined implementation, evidence creation, documentation, learning, and measurable community-linked impact.

Why does U2I use pilot-based strengthening?

Pilot-based strengthening allows NGOs to learn by doing. It creates practical experience, execution discipline, field evidence, measurable outputs, and confidence for future partnerships.

Building Trust for Collaboration

How can CSR teams partner with U2I Foundation?

CSR teams can engage with U2I Foundation for structured NGO ecosystem strengthening, implementation partnerships, guided pilot support, institutional readiness pathways, and community-linked impact collaboration.

Is U2I Foundation a CSR implementation partner?

U2I Foundation can function as a structured ecosystem partner for CSR teams by strengthening NGO readiness, enabling guided implementation pathways, and supporting credible community-linked impact ecosystems.

Does U2I guarantee CSR funding or grants?

No. U2I Foundation does not guarantee CSR funding, grants, donations, government approvals, or corporate partnerships. U2I strengthens NGOs so they become more structured, credible, and partnership-ready.
